The Public Prosecutor has ordered the referral to the Criminal Court of a pharmacist and her collaborator. For accusing them of intentionally injuring the two children, Iman and Sajada, with an injection in Alexandria, which led to their death, after the Public Prosecutor’s Office verified the testimony of 9 witnesses against them, and what was demonstrated by the complaints from the Legal Medicine Authorities, and what was found during the inspection by the Pharmacy Prosecutor’s Office on the scene of the accident and the surveillance of the monitoring machines contained therein, and what was admitted by the two defendants in their investigations.

The investigation concluded that the defendant, who works in a pharmacy, injected cefotaxime into the two female victims without testing its sensitivity, and is not authorized to practice as a human doctor, as injecting patients is an act affecting the human body, and it is forbidden to do so without obtaining a permit to practice the profession. Medicine, the hypersensitivity of the two girls to that substance led to complications which ended with a drop in their blood circulation and an insufficiency of their respiratory functions, which led to their death in the manner established by the anatomical report of their bodies issued by the Legal Medicine Authority.

The investigations confirmed that the defendant pharmacist participated with the other in the crime through instigation and assistance, as she incited her to inject the two girls while she was not qualified to practice medicine, and helped her by placing her in able to use the tools, materials and medicines necessary for the injections in the pharmacy, therefore the crime was committed on the basis of this instigation and that assistance.

Among the evidence invoked by the prosecutor against the two defendants was the testimony of the parents of the two victims, who confirmed that the pharmacy worker was the one who injected the drug into their daughters without testing their sensitivity. of the two victims was a result of hypersensitivity to the drug they were injected with, which caused complications in their bodies that ended in their death, and that the direct cause of death was their injection without conducting a sensitivity test.

And the prosecutor had found, during the inspection of the pharmacy, the remains of syringes, which the chemical laboratory report proved to contain the same active ingredient of the drug with which the two girls had been injected, and the defendant who worked in the pharmacy confirmed that these remains were the ones he used in the accident.

The Public Prosecutor’s Office also relied on the statements of the two defendants in the investigations, which led the defendant pharmacist to give the other the task of injecting the two girls with the aforementioned drug without testing its sensitivity. she injected them and signs and symptoms of allergy subsequently appeared, and the two defendants confronted the recordings and acknowledged their authenticity.

The prosecutor had appointed three female pharmacists inspectors from the Egyptian Medicines Authority, members of the committee formed by the prosecutor to inspect and inventory the contents of the pharmacy at the scene of the accident, and who confirmed with their testimony in the investigation that the pharmacists are not allowed to give patients injections, considering that this work is an authentic act of doctors alone, and it is not. also confirmed, through their inspection of the pharmacy, that there are several violations in it.

The Public Prosecutor challenged the defendant working in a pharmacy for exercising the profession of human doctor without being registered in the medical register, in contrast with the provisions of the law, as well as for exercising the profession of pharmacist without a license. The Public Prosecutor also instructed the pharmacist to allow the other to practice this profession in his name within the pharmacy.
